When the Yankees signed DJ LeMahieu away from the Colorado Rockies, he was expected to be a versatile middle infielder who would platoon with Troy Tulowitzki. Instead of that, LeMahieu has blossomed into their leadoff hitter and an indispensable member of the team. The utility-man continued his scintillating 2019 with a three-run home run off of Toronto Blue Jays reliever Derek Law to give the Yankees a 7-4 lead north of the border.

Despite playing in Colorado for seven years, LeMahieu had only hit more than 10 home runs twice in his career. He's well on his way towards another double-digit bomb campaign.
That newfound power stroke, which has a habit of cropping up in clutch situations where they need him, is a major plus for the Yankees.
